Some people believe that reprogramming fobs' keys themselves will save them money. This may be the case. Based on the model, some fobs can be programmed using instructions in the vehicle owner's manual or on the internet without the need to take it to an authorized dealer. This isn't possible for certain fobs, like those that are integrated into the vehicle's key or require an FOBIK chip.
A few large retailers of auto parts like AutoZone offer replacement remotes that come with instructions on how to self-programmed. This is not true for the majority of vehicles. They need to be connected to the computer of the vehicle with specific equipment to ensure that the device works properly. This is a risky procedure, as any wrong steps could corrupt the data stored on the key fob. This is why it's typically best to leave this job to professionals.

Certain manufacturers restrict dealers from selling and programming key fobs from aftermarket manufacturers. The aftermarket key fobs have an entirely different encryption method than the original keyfob from the manufacturer, which could cause problems with your car's security system. Some dealers have told us that they could program key fobs for aftermarket use if the owner understood the risks.
A professional locksmith uses an instrument called a programmable transponder, which allows you to program a new key fob for your vehicle. This tool can identify the unique serial number as well as other details on your car's key fob. Then, it will match the data to the proper key code in your car's computer system.

No matter if your vehicle is new or old keys can be subject to hacking attempts. Criminals employ specialized devices which amplify signals to trick your vehicle and its key fob into thinking they're closer than they are. This could cause the key fob to open or turn on your engine, which could cause theft. You can purchase devices like faraday bags to block these signals.
